Overview

A single phase solid state relay (SSR) is an all-electronic device that switches AC power using semiconductor components like thyristors or triacs. Unlike electromechanical relays, SSRs have no moving parts, enabling silent, spark-free operation with faster response times (typically 1–10 ms). Module-style SSRs are compact, self-contained units with screw terminals for easy installation. They are commonly rated for 24–480V AC loads and control currents from 10A to 100A+, making them versatile for industrial and commercial applications.

Structure and Working Principle

The SSR consists of an input circuit (optocoupler or transformer-isolated), a trigger circuit, and an output semiconductor switch (e.g., back-to-back thyristors). When a low-voltage DC signal (3–32V) is applied to the input, the optocoupler activates the trigger, turning the output semiconductors on/off. Zero-crossing SSRs synchronize switching with the AC waveform to reduce inrush currents, while random-turn-on models provide instant switching. The epoxy resin casing ensures insulation and heat resistance, though external heat sinks are often required for high-current models.

Key Features

Solid state relays offer exceptional durability, typically exceeding 10 million cycles—far surpassing electromechanical relays. Their sealed construction resists dust, humidity, and vibration, ideal for harsh environments. Other advantages include no contact bounce, low EMI emissions, and compatibility with PLCs and microcontrollers. However, they generate heat during operation and may require protective circuits (e.g., snubbers) for inductive loads to prevent voltage spikes.

Application Areas

Single phase SSRs are widely used in industrial heating systems (ovens, furnaces), packaging machinery, and HVAC controls due to precise temperature regulation. They also power motor soft starters, lighting systems, and automated test equipment. In B2B contexts, SSRs are favored for production lines requiring frequent switching, such as plastic molding machines or conveyor systems. Their maintenance-free operation reduces downtime compared to mechanical relays.

Maintenance and Precautions

SSRs require minimal maintenance but must be properly heatsinked—operating temperatures should stay below 80°C. Ensure adequate airflow and use thermal paste for optimal heat transfer. Avoid overloading: Derate current by 30–50% for inductive loads. Install surge suppressors (e.g., MOVs) with motors or transformers. Always disconnect power before wiring, and verify load compatibility with the SSR’s voltage/current ratings.

B2B Procurement Guide

When sourcing SSRs, prioritize suppliers with ISO-certified manufacturing and robust technical support. Key specifications include load current/voltage, control voltage range, and switching type (zero-crossing vs. random). For bulk purchases (100+ units), negotiate volume discounts—prices often drop 10–20%. Lead times vary from 1–6 weeks; opt for local distributors for urgent needs. Reputable brands include Crydom, Omron, and Celduc, offering warranties of 1–3 years.
